Evidence Checklist

  • Police crash report number
  • Photos and videos of the vehicles and scene
  • All medical records, bills, and imaging
  • Pay stubs or an employer letter showing lost income
  • Insurance claim numbers and adjuster contact information

Mistakes To Avoid

  • Giving a recorded statement before speaking with a lawyer
  • Delaying medical treatment
  • Posting about the crash on social media
  • Accepting the first settlement offer without knowing your full damages
  • Missing Georgia's 2-year filing deadline

Frequently Asked Questions

How long do I have to file a car accident claim in {location}?

In Georgia you typically have 2 years from the date of the accident to file a personal injury claim under O.C.G.A. § 9-3-33.

What damages can I recover after a car accident?

You may recover med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, property damage, future medical costs, and loss of earning capacity.

Should I talk to the other driver's insurance company?

It's best to let your attorney handle communication with the other party's insurer. Adjusters are trained to minimize payouts, and what you say early can be used against you later.

What if the other driver was uninsured?

Your own u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age may apply. Georgia requires UM/UIM coverage unless you specifically reject it in writing.
